OLX88 is your one-stop destination for a vast range of online services. Whether you're seeking for reliable platforms, innovative media, or cutting-edge shopping solutions, OLX88 has everything to fulfill your needs. https://linklist.bio/olx88
Discover OLX88: Your Gateway to Premier Online Services
Internet - 2 hours 42 minutes ago aoifeehge402942Web Directory Categories
Web Directory Search
New Site Listings